Louisiana College is located in Pineville, Louisiana and has a total student population of 1,153.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 3 students received a bachelor's degree in Fine Arts from Louisiana College.

Careers That Fine Arts Grads May Go Into

A degree in Fine Arts can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for LA, the home state for Louisiana College.

Occupation Jobs in LA Average Salary in LA
High School Teachers 13,930 $51,810
Photographers 510 $32,710
Art, Drama, and Music Professors 490 $61,980
Jewelers, Precious Stone and Metal Workers 460 $36,820
Curators 140 $42,190
